<h1>Japan election poised to enable major shifts in defence, export and immigration rules with implications for civil liberties.</h1> The projected lower-house supermajority for Prime Minister Takaichi's coalition would enable expedited legislative revisions to defence and security policy, including lifting weapons-export limits, enhancing offensive capabilities, increasing defence spending, and implementing tougher anti-espionage and immigration controls, raising potential tensions between national-security aims and civil-rights protections.
